Game Related

The maximum stat cap has been raised.
Your damage to monsters will now be affected by the difference in their level and yours. If they are lower level than you, your damage will be increased by a certain percentage but if they are higher than you, then your damage will be reduced.
Ability Reorganization
Honor level has been removed. You can now reset your Inner Ability by using your Honor experience, and you can use it even if your Ability is Legendary rank. You can also use your Honor experience to lock an Ability’s rank or stats. Current Circulators and Miracle Circulators will work the same as they do now.

Maple Tutorial
The Maple Tutorial has been added! It is available for users level 10 to 140, and will recommend quests, maps, and content based on your level. Quests recommended by the tutorial can be automatically started remotely, and you can also teleport to any recommended maps or content instantly.

Zakum
Zakum’s prequests and conditions have been reorganized. You can now fight Zakum in all channels, and the Zakum expedition has been deleted, you must now enter with a party. Anyone level 50 or higher can talk to the job advancers in El Nath to be instantly teleported to the Door to Zakum. They will also give you Zakum’s All Cure Potions.
You no longer need to do stage 1 or 2 of the Zakum prequests (they give only experience and mesos now), Adobis will give you Eyes of Fire and Eye of Fire Fragments. You can now only enter Zakum’s altar twice per day, regardless of mode. Easy/Normal/Chaos Zakum’s entry limits now reset at midnight.
Updated Buddy List
The account buddy system has been added! Now, when you add a friend, you can choose for them to be listed as an ‘account buddy’, meaning all characters in the same world will share that person on their buddy lists. You can change your existing buddies into account buddies by right clicking on them and choosing the option.
A new system called offline login has been added. Now when you choose a character and put in your 2nd password, you can choose to ‘connect privately’, meaning your friends will not receive a popup that you logged in and you’ll appear offline in their buddy lists. You can also change your status while being logged in by clicking the option in the buddy window.
In accordance with the above two things, the buddy UI has been updated! Almost all the buttons have been moved into the right-click menu and you can now give nicknames to any account buddies you have.

Enhancement System Changes

Scroll Trace Upgrading
The scroll enhancement system has been changed. You can now use Scroll Traces to upgrade your items (I mentioned these in my last post from some events but I didn’t know what they were for, this is it!). These Scroll Traces can be found by hunting monsters or disassembling scrolls.
The higher the level of your equipment, the lower the success rate and the higher the amount of Scroll Traces that will be used to upgrade your item. These upgrades will take up slots just like regular scrolls. You can still use any other regular scrolls on your items if you want to.

Field Battle System Changes

Field monsters’ health and experience have been increased. Any monsters below level 100 have had their HP increased by 2x and their experience by 1.2x. Monsters above level 100 have had their HP increased by 2~9x and their experience increased by 1.2~4x.
The Rune system has been added! After certain periods of time, Runes will spawn in fields. By pressing <Space Bar> on a Rune, you will be given an input command to enter in order to gain the effects of the Rune. You cannot use any other Runes until 10 minutes has passed. Runes have a variety of effects, but one common one they have is that they will give you 2x experience for 2 minutes. In addition, depending on the type of Rune, you’ll get one of the following:
  • Rune of Speed: for 2 minutes, your speed and attack speed will be increased
  • Rune of Energy: for 2 minutes, you will heal 10% of your HP every second, gain 20% resistance to elements, and receive 20% less damage from monsters
  • Rune of Decay: Instantly kill any enemies around you and for 2 minutes, gain 50% damage
  • Rune of Destruction: for 15 seconds, all monsters’ HP will be reduced by 10% and for 2 minutes, gain 50% damage
Elite Monster
Elite Monsters have been added. If you meet certain conditions, an Elite Monster will appear! They are two times as large as regular monsters and they’ll have increased health, damage, and experience. They’ll use one of a random set of skills.
When defeated, Elite Monsters will drop enhanced rewards of the monster it was, and if its level 110 or higher, it will also drop Rare~Epic equipment, Cubes and Flames of Reincarnation, Golden Hammers, or Protection Scrolls.
Elite Bosses have also been added! If you meet certain conditions, an Elite Boss will appear. When they do, all other monsters will disappear and only Elite Monsters will remain. When an Elite Boss spawns, all nearby maps will receive a message showing which map it is in.
After defeating an Elite Boss, a bonus stage will trigger. In this bonus stage, you can get a large amount of experience and mesos, Rare~Unique equipment less than level 120, various Cubes and Flames of Reincarnation, Additional Potential Stamps, Epic Potential Scrolls, or Protection Scrolls.

Battle System Changes

The battle system has been changed. The time of invincibility after being attacked has been reduced.
Combo Kills
Combo Kill and Multi Kill systems have been added. When you kill 3 or more monsters in one skill, it counts as a Multi Kill, and when you kill many monsters in a row, it counts as Combo Kills. Based on your Multi Kill and Combo Kill streaks, you’ll receive bonus experience from monsters.
Party bonus experience has been increased. Instead of being in only specific maps, party play bonuses will now be available in all maps! If you have 2 or more members in a party, your bonus experience increase proportionally. It will range from 125% to 275% based on the number of party members.
If your party attacks the same monster, its experience will be increased in proportion to the number of party members, up to 3 people. This system will be restricted or reduced in certain content however.
New Damage Effects
The display of damage effects has been changed. In the options you can now choose between the existing and new damage effects. It basically makes damage ‘fade out’ by moving up and becoming smaller. It also applies to damage taken.

Skill Changes

Based on the changes to monsters’ HP and experience, instant kill skills have been adjusted.
  • Extreme Magic (IL) Ice/Lightning Archmage – Extreme Magic (I/L): chance of instant death has been decreased from 15% to 10%
  •  Ranger – Mortal Blow: chance of instant death has been decreased from 15% to 10%
  • Advanced Charge Paladin – Advanced Charge: chance of instant death has been decreased from 10% to 5%
  • Beholder's Revenge Dark Knight – Beholder’s Revenge: chance of instant death has been decreased from 30% to 10%
  • Dark Impale Dark Knight – Dark Impale: chance of instant death has been decreased from 10% to 2%
  • Battleship Bomber Captain – Battleship Bomber: chance of instant death has been decreased from 100% to 20%
  • Blue Streak Kaiser – Blue Streak: chance of instant death has been decreased from 25% to 10%
  • Advanced Earth Break Zero – Advanced Earth Break: chance of instant death has been decreased from 20% to 10%
  • Advanced Storm Break Zero – Advanced Storm Break: chance of instant death has been decreased from 10% to 5%
  • Don't Block my Way Soul Weapon – Get out of my Way
Other skills that have instant kill effects but have not been changed may be adjusted or replaced in later balance patches. These include:
  • Final Cut Dual Blade – Final Cut: this skill has a long cooldown, so the instant death usage is low
  • Highkick Demolition Mercedes – High Kick Demolition: chance of instant death is low
  • Absolute Kill Luminous – Absolute Kill: 100% chance to instantly kill an enemy is the main concept of the skill
  • Sniping Marksman – Sniping: 100% chance to instantly kill an enemy and no cooldown is currently the concept of the skill. By collecting data after the patch, effect might be changed.
  • Head Shot Captain – Headshot: see Sniping
  •  Wild Hunter character card effect: chance to activate is very low

Item Related

Third Rogue Set
Equipment under level 100 have had set effects added! These sets apply for 20 level intervals (I think this means that for example, one set will include both the level 60 and 70 equipment?).
The one above is the Third Rogue set and uses the level 90 set with the level 80 gloves. The 2 set effect is bad but the 3 set gives 4% HP and MP, and the 4 set gives 4 LUK and 4 attack. I think this is a good change to make lower level equipment useful!
Field monsters’ equipment drop rate has been decreased. The selling price of equipment under level 110 has been increased. The fees to identify potential on equipment less than level 120 have been decreased. Equipment levels 30~70′s fees have been reduced by 75% and equipment levels 70~120′s fees have been reduced by 50%.

Auction House Related

The base number of selling slots has been increased to 5. The base number of searches per day has been increased to 10. The basic sales commission has been decreased to 5%.

The Forgotten Hero, EunWol

EunWol
The sixth hero, EunWol has been added into the data! He is confirmed to be a pirate class that uses STR and a knuckle.
Male and Female EunWol
EunWol is not gender-restricted, but the illustrations of him are definitely the male version (take that, everyone who said he was a girl!). In addition, EunWol’s character card effects are 1%/2%/3%/5% minimum and maximum critical damage.
